Ultralight Gear Buying Guide:
Not sure what you need in an ultralight spinning rod? Let’s go through the parts of a rod and reel that all ultralight spinning rods will feature and how they affect performance.
What to Look For in an Ultralight Rod
Power
Power is the strength of a spinning rod, and in this case, we only want one power of the rod, and that is Ultralight power. Ultralight rods are about as light as you can go in the fishing rod world and are niche rods specifically tailored to fishing for smaller species like panfish and trout.
Action
In most cases, you are going to want to choose a rod with moderate to fast action. It won’t be hard to find an ultralight spinning rod with this action, as most rods on the market are created with this action in mind.
The Action of a rod determines the amount of flex in the rod when it’s under a weight load like a fish or even just your lure. Action can give hard and fast hooksets to softer hooksets with the same power rod, depending on that action.
Length
Most rods in the ultralight spinning rod category are all created at similar lengths, this is due to the action and power of the rod. If the rod is too long, it will be too floppy without enough backbone, too short, and it will be very stiff without having the proper flex.
Exceptions to the average length of these rods can be made. For instance, the Zebco dock demon was specifically designed to be short, but the spinning rod’s blank design and construction will reflect its short length.
What to Look For in an Ultralight Spinning Reel
Since ultralight spinning combos have both a rod and reel, the job of finding a suitable reel is made simple by having one already included that works great with the rod it is paired with.
When choosing a combo with a great spinning reel, look for spinning reels with a large number of ball bearings for the ball bearing drive; bearings that are made from stainless steel are preferred, as an instant anti-reverse clutch, all-metal gears, a good drag like carbon fiber drag, and stainless steel components. It is always good to ensure that these smaller reels have enough line capacity.
These options will ensure the reel will withstand the test of time and the fight when you hook into larger game fish.
Ultralight Fishing FAQs
What Is Ultralight Fishing?
Ultralight fishing is when you target small fishing like bluegill, crappie, small trout, and other small species using an ultralight spinning rod. The use of the Ultralight spinning rod means that you are limited in the size of lures you can use.
Typically you are running a 6-pound test line or less, and your setup is best suited to light lures like small jigs, spinners, and crankbaits, as well as the standard traditional bobber style of live bait fishing.
What Species Can You Target?
Species typically targeted when fishing an ultralight would be bluegill, perch, crappie, sunfish, smaller trout like those found in small streams, tilapia, or any other fish that are of a similar size with light lures or live bait.
Quality ultralight rods are very sensitive, and anglers will be able to feel even the lightest bite from small fish like panfish, whereas when fishing with a medium action rod, you might struggle to feel these small bites.
Can You Land a Big Fish on Ultralight Gear?
You can land larger fish like bass or pike with an ultralight, but it typically is not an easy affair. These larger fish are usually caught by accident, and in many cases, due to light lures and light lines, the fish is lost due to the breaking of the fishing line due to the power of the fish, or the line is cut by sharp teeth.
If a large fish is caught, the only real option is to adjust your drag and try to play the fish out or fight the fish until it is exhausted; this can take a long time and depends on the line capacity, which is not high even with the best ultralight spinning reels.
In many cases, the fish may tangle you in branches or bury in the weeds, and without the power to pull them out or control them, your line will most likely break.
